Latest Patents

Among his latest innovations is a system and method for dispensing prescriptions. This automated method is designed for dispensing pharmaceuticals, particularly tablets and capsules, as well as other small discrete objects. The process includes receiving prescription information, selecting a container, labeling the container, dispensing the tablets or capsules into the labeled container, applying a closure to the filled, labeled container, and offloading the container to a designated location. The system employs high-speed dispensing bins that utilize forced air to agitate and singulate the tablets, ensuring a precise and efficient dispensing operation.
